Target group
Graduates of a Bachelor's degree course or equivalent academic degree in English Studies, Educational Science, Protestant Theology, German Studies, History, Catholic Theology, Art History, Latin Philology, Musicology, Philosophy, Religious Studies, Political Science or Romance Studies
Annotation
\t opens up the opportunity for doctoral studies and, with the appropriate course planning/fulfilment of the relevant requirements, admission to any possible doctorate\; in accordance with this for the PhD programme on Migration Research and Intercultural Studies at the Universität Osnabrück.
\t It broadly qualifies students through the combination of strongly theoretical and practice-oriented courses for a professional role in different cultural organisations and producers, in theological and church-based fields of work, including in the field of media, the independent education sector, associations and companies (for example, public relations, human resources management, cultural affairs), tourism, guidance and coaching.
Admission requirements
Bachelor's degree course or equivalent academic degree in English Studies, Educational Science, Protestant Theology, German Language and Literature, History, Catholic Theology, Art History, Latin Philology, Musicology, Philosophy, Religious Studies, Political Science, Romance Studies or another closely related degree programme with a subject-related component of at least 70 credit points.
